Output 3668e7b397825c37876ce3c231a2dbf08f18bb04e722f3c0ba19f0677fcd5bf5:0

value
128315600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da23e7dc609504839f578f902d4bb829ad090dbf OP_EQUALVERIFY OP_CHECKSIG
address
1LtRKbHyDQZHH1KSpLJUMQ941uUtPmUycr
transaction
3668e7b397825c37876ce3c231a2dbf08f18bb04e722f3c0ba19f0677fcd5bf5
spent
true